| dc.description.abstract | In conventional method, fertilizer is applied at a uniform dosage for all location of a field. However, each location within the field needs different amount of fertilizer according to the soil nutrient content and growth condition of crop. For that purpose, it is important to develop a fertilizer applicator that allows a prescribe rate of fertilizer to be applied at each location within the field, based on recommended dose. The objectives of this research were: 1) to design digital metering system to control the application rate of a variable rate granular fertilizer applicator, 2) to develop a prototype of 4 rows granular fertilizer applicator, that can provide prescribe application rate automatically, and 3) to obtain field performance data of the prototype. A prototype of the variable rate granular fertilizer applicator was designed and constructed.The metering device consisted of two fluted wheel type of rotors which was driven by controlled DC-motor. To provide a prescribe rate of fertilizer, a control system based on microcontroller DT-AVR ATmega128L modul was developed and set to control the speed of the rotor. The prototype then was tested using three types of granular fertilizers (Urea, SP-36 and NPK), on stationary test and field tests. The stationary test result showed that the PID controller could control and provided a proportional correlation between application rate and rotor speed. The field performance test result showed that the designed prototype could provide a proper predetermined application rate of fertilizers precisely. The average deviations of the application rate for 50, 100, 150, 200, 250 kg/ha dose of Urea were -1.67 , 3.33, 0.28, 2.71 and 1.33 % respectively. For SP-36 were -21.67, -5.42, -2.47, -2.71, and -1.67 %. respectively. For NPK were -18.33, -4.17, -4.17, -3.75 and -2.33 % respectively. | en |
